K-12 Education
The Washington State Attorney General Office (AGO) funded Battelle's Pacific Northwest Division (Battelle) to investigate ways to increase energy efficiency awareness in the K-12 student community. Based on guidance from teachers and school district curriculum developers, Battelle developed energy efficiency lessons plans that support the Washington State Science Learning Standards and the Washington State Integrated Environmental and Sustainability Education Learning Standards.
During the 2010 summer break, two teachers, Brian Smith, Richland High, (Richland, Washington) and Lisa Love, Wendell High School, (Wendell, Idaho), working under Battelle's Pacific Northwest Division/DOE Academies Creating Teacher Scientists (ACTS) program assisted Battelle's in developing the lesson plans for grades Kindergarten through eight (K-8). Battelle is now working to deliver the lesson plans to a wide range of teachers to promote energy efficiency and to obtain additional feedback.
Battelle trained teachers in a three-hour workshop titled "Save Energy-Everyday-Everywhere for Grades 3-5" on November 18, 2010, as one of the Content Series provided by the partnership between Leadership and Assistance for Science Education Reform (LASER), Educational Service District (ESD) 123, and Battelle's Pacific Northwest Division Science & Engineering Education program.
